TOM CRUISE joined the Church of Scientology in 1990, asserting the mind-over-matter religious beliefs assisted him overcome dyslexia. Founded by pulp-fiction author L. Ron Hubbard in 1952, Scientology stresses a self-help system called Dianetics. The Church of Scientology was included as a religion in Camden, N.J., and educates converts that human beings are never-ceasing beings that have forgotten their true nature.

Hubbard went to George Washington University, Washington, D.C. (193032 ), but left to go after other rate of interests without completing his degree. He married in 1933 and settled down to an occupation as an author. His creating extended numerous genresfrom westerns to scary and science fictionand he was a prominent contributor to pulp publications.

His preliminary conclusions appeared in The Initial Thesis (1948 ), prior to an extra fully grown discussion in Dianetics.

A vital element of this procedure is use an E-meter. Scientology, a tool that determines the stamina of a small electric current that passes through the body of the person going through auditing. According to church teachings, E-meter readings show changes in emotions that permit the recognition of kept engrams

The most sacred mentors of Scientology (the operating thetan, or OT, levels) are interested in assisting the private to run as a totally conscious and operating thetan. The private Scientologist is site here also encouraged to establish a more comprehensive worldview by understanding ever bigger truths, or "characteristics." At the earliest phase, the private experiences the urge to survive as a private initial but after that learns to understand three other dynamicsthe household, the people or country, and all mankind.
